About The Position

Conduct desktop inventory validation reviews for U.S. Consulate facilities in Mexico. Review, validate, standardize, and document facility asset data to ensure records meet established program requirements and support an industry-aligned asset naming and reporting structure. Use the BUILDER Sustainment Management System (SMS) to review asset inventories, resolve data discrepancies, support data quality assurance, and prepare accurate reports for Government review.

Responsibilities

  • Conduct detailed desktop reviews of facility inventory records for assigned U.S. Consulates in Mexico. Review existing asset information, supporting documentation, facility records, drawings, photographs, prior assessment data, and other available source materials to validate asset records. Confirm assets are correctly identified, categorized, named, and reported in accordance with program standards and industry-aligned conventions.
  • Use BUILDER SMS to review, validate, update, and maintain facility asset inventory information. Verify that asset attributes, locations, quantities, systems, components, and condition-related data are complete and accurately recorded. Identify duplicate, incomplete, outdated, or inconsistent records and take appropriate action to correct or elevate discrepancies for resolution.
  • Apply established naming conventions, asset hierarchies, classification standards, and reporting requirements to inventory data. Ensure asset names and descriptions are consistent, clear, traceable, and aligned with approved facility management and sustainment practices. Support standardization across multiple consulate locations to enable reliable portfolio-level reporting and analysis.
  • Perform quality-control checks on validated asset records before final submission. Identify missing information, data anomalies, conflicting source information, and records that do not meet required naming or reporting standards. Document findings, recommended corrections, assumptions, and unresolved issues in accordance with established quality-assurance procedures.
  • Prepare inventory validation logs, discrepancy trackers, data-quality reports, and status updates for the Program Manager and Government stakeholders. Maintain clear documentation of review actions, source materials used, corrections made, and items requiring additional verification. Develop reports from BUILDER and related systems as required to support program oversight, planning, and decision-making.
  • Coordinate with program management, facility personnel, subject-matter experts, and other team members to resolve inventory questions and obtain clarification on asset records. Communicate data issues clearly, professionally, and promptly. Participate in project meetings, status reviews, and technical discussions as assigned.
  • Follow Government, client, and company policies governing data management, records handling, information security, and quality control. Protect sensitive facility and asset information. Maintain organized electronic files and ensure work products meet required deadlines and established performance standards.
